Mandatory: Automation Tester Responsibilities

  • Define and evolve the automation approach for your product area, ensuring we test the right things at the right layers (API, UI, contract, component, etc.).
  • Identify weak spots in our quality pipeline and introduce tools or techniques that tighten feedback loops.
  • Drive continuous improvement of automation frameworks-making them cleaner, faster, and easier for others to build on.
  • Lead the design, development, and maintenance of test automation frameworks and scripts.
  • Define automation strategies, standards, and best practices to ensure consistency across QA teams.
  • Collaborate with development, DevOps, and business teams to integrate automation into continuous delivery pipelines.
  • Integrate automation deeply into pipelines; optimise parallel runs and ensure deterministic, stable outputs.
  • Investigate flaky tests, eliminate root causes, and enforce reliability standards.
  • Provide meaningful reporting that highlights real risks, not just raw numbers.
  • Conduct code reviews of automation scripts and provide mentorship to junior and mid-level automation engineers.
  • Develop reusable components, utilities, and libraries to improve efficiency and maintainability of test automation assets.
  • Analyze and troubleshoot complex automation failures, identifying root causes and corrective actions.
  • Provide technical input into test planning, estimation, and overall QA strategy.
  • Evaluate and recommend automation tools and technologies that align with enterprise architecture.
  • Track and report on automation progress and performance metrics to QA leadership.
  • Ensure alignment of automation testing activities with compliance and security requirements relevant to healthcare data systems.
  • Collaborate with peers to enhance automation coverage for API, UI, batch, and Back End testing layers.
  • Guide mid-level and junior QA/SDET engineers, reviewing their test code and helping them grow.
  • Run short learning sessions on testing techniques, automation frameworks, and debugging skills.
  • Promote good habits like clean test coding, reliable assertions, and defensible test structure.
  • Champion test automation adoption and continuous improvement initiatives across QA and development teams.
  • Advocate for shifts-left behaviours such as early test case design, contract validation, and exploratory testing.
  • Recommend improvements to engineering workflows, branching strategies, and test environment usage.
  • Bring fresh ideas from industry trends-new frameworks, patterns, and tooling that could elevate quality.

Qualification & Technical Skills:

  • Required Qualifications: Bachelor's or master's degree in computer science, Information Systems, or related field.
  • 8+ years of experience in software testing.
  • 5 years in automation-focused roles.
  • Proven expertise in designing and maintaining automation frameworks (Selenium, Cypress, Tosca, Playwright, or UFT).
  • Exposure to dashboard tools like Grafana is good to have.
  • Expertise in automation tools like Selenium, Cypress, Playwright, Cucumber, Postman, Restassured.
  • Expertise in CI/CD tools such as Jenkins, GitLab CI, Azure DevOps pipelines.
  • Expertise in performance testing tools like JMeter, Gatling, LoadRunner.
  • Working knowledge of security testing tools like SonarQube, OWASP ZAP, Burp Suite, Prowler, Kali Linux, Fortify, Veracode, Teneble.io, Jfrog Xray.
  • Strong programming proficiency in Java and Python.
  • Solid understanding of CI/CD practices, with hands-on experience integrating automated tests into pipelines (e.g., Jenkins, Azure DevOps).
  • Deep understanding of SDLC, STLC, and Agile methodologies.
  • Proficient in database validation and complex SQL Scripting.
  • Experience leading automation initiatives for large, multi-tiered enterprise or healthcare systems.
